Range Sum Query 2D - ដំណោះស្រាយ Leetcode ដែលមិនអាចផ្លាស់ប្តូរបាន។

Problem Statement Range Sum Query 2D – Immutable Leetcode Solution – ដែលបានផ្តល់ឱ្យម៉ាទ្រីស 2D ដោះស្រាយសំណួរជាច្រើននៃប្រភេទខាងក្រោម៖ គណនាផលបូកនៃធាតុនៃម៉ាទ្រីសនៅខាងក្នុងចតុកោណកែងដែលកំណត់ដោយជ្រុងខាងឆ្វេងខាងលើរបស់វា (ជួរដេកទី 1, col1) និងផ្នែកខាងក្រោមខាងស្តាំ។ ជ្រុង (ជួរដេក 2, col2) ។ អនុវត្តថ្នាក់ NumMatrix៖ NumMatrix(int[][] matrix) ចាប់ផ្តើមវត្ថុដោយចំនួនគត់…

អាន​បន្ថែម

Partition Labels ដំណោះស្រាយ LeetCode

បញ្ហាសេចក្តីថ្លែងការណ៍ភាគថាសស្លាក ដំណោះស្រាយ LeetCode - អ្នកត្រូវបានផ្តល់ខ្សែអក្សរ s ។ យើងចង់បែងចែកខ្សែអក្សរទៅជាផ្នែកជាច្រើនតាមដែលអាចធ្វើបានដើម្បីឱ្យអក្សរនីមួយៗលេចឡើងនៅផ្នែកមួយភាគច្រើន។ ចំណាំថាភាគថាសត្រូវបានធ្វើដូច្នេះបន្ទាប់ពីភ្ជាប់ផ្នែកទាំងអស់តាមលំដាប់លំដោយ ...

អាន​បន្ថែម

ដំណោះស្រាយ LeetCode ឆ្លងកាត់តាមអង្កត់ទ្រូង

Problem Statement Diagonal Traversal LeetCode Solution - ផ្តល់លេខអារេចំនួនគត់ 2D ត្រឡប់ធាតុទាំងអស់នៃលេខតាមលំដាប់អង្កត់ទ្រូងដូចបង្ហាញក្នុងរូបភាពខាងក្រោម។ បញ្ចូល៖ លេខ = [[1,2,3],[4,5,6],[7,8,9]] លទ្ធផល៖ [1,4,2,7,5,3,8,6,9] ការពន្យល់សម្រាប់ Diagonal Traversal LeetCode Solution Key Idea ជួរទីមួយ និងជួរចុងក្រោយក្នុងបញ្ហានេះនឹងបម្រើ…

អាន​បន្ថែម

ច្រកចេញជិតបំផុតពីច្រកចូលក្នុង Maze LeetCode Solution

សេចក្តីថ្លែងការណ៍បញ្ហាដែលនៅជិតបំផុត ច្រកចេញពីច្រកចូលក្នុងដំណោះស្រាយ Maze LeetCode – យើងត្រូវបានផ្តល់ម៉ាទ្រីស mxn “maze” (0-indexed) ជាមួយនឹងក្រឡាទទេតំណាងថា '.' និងជញ្ជាំងជា '+' ។ អ្នក​ក៏​ត្រូវ​បាន​ផ្តល់​ឱ្យ​ច្រក​ចូល​នៃ​ maze ដែល​ច្រកចូល = [entrance_row, entry_col] តំណាង​ឱ្យ​ជួរ​ដេក និង​ជួរ​ឈរ…

អាន​បន្ថែម

ដំណោះស្រាយ Tic-Tac-Toe State LeetCode ដែលមានសុពលភាព

សេចក្តីថ្លែងការណ៍បញ្ហាដែលមានសុពលភាព Tic-Tac-Toe State LeetCode Solution - យើងត្រូវបានផ្តល់ឱ្យក្រុមប្រឹក្សាភិបាល Tic-Tac-Toe ជាបន្ទះអារេខ្សែ ហើយត្រូវបានស្នើសុំឱ្យត្រឡប់ពិត ប្រសិនបើវាគឺអាចធ្វើទៅបានដើម្បីឈានដល់ទីតាំងក្រុមប្រឹក្សាភិបាលនេះក្នុងអំឡុងពេលនៃ tic- ហ្គេម tac-toe ។ បន្ទះក្តារជាអារេ 3 x 3…

អាន​បន្ថែម

បន្ថយធាតុដើម្បីបង្កើតដំណោះស្រាយ Array Zigzag LeetCode

សេចក្តីថ្លែងការណ៍បញ្ហា៖ បន្ថយធាតុដើម្បីបង្កើតដំណោះស្រាយ Array Zigzag LeetCode – ដោយផ្តល់ចំនួនចំនួនគត់អារេ ចលនាមួយមានការជ្រើសរើសធាតុណាមួយ ហើយបន្ថយវាដោយ 1 ។ អារេ A គឺជាអារេ zigzag ប្រសិនបើទាំងពីរ៖ រាល់ធាតុដែលមានលិបិក្រមគូគឺធំជាង ធាតុដែលនៅជាប់គ្នា, ឧ។ A[0] > A[1] < A[2] > A[3] < A[4] > … …

អាន​បន្ថែម

ត្រងភោជនីយដ្ឋានតាម Vegan-Friendly តម្លៃ និងដំណោះស្រាយ Leetcode ពីចម្ងាយ

សេចក្តីថ្លែងការណ៍បញ្ហា ត្រងភោជនីយដ្ឋានតាម Vegan-Friendly, Price, and Distance Leetcode Solution – ដែលបានផ្ដល់ឱ្យភោជនីយដ្ឋានអារេដែលភោជនីយដ្ឋាន[i] = [idi, ratingi, veganFriendlyi, pricei, distancei]។ អ្នកត្រូវត្រងភោជនីយដ្ឋានដោយប្រើតម្រងបី។ តម្រង veganFriendly នឹងក្លាយជាការពិត (មានន័យថាអ្នកគួរតែបញ្ចូលតែភោជនីយដ្ឋានជាមួយ veganFriendlyi កំណត់វាទៅជាពិត) ឬមិនពិត (មានន័យថាអ្នកអាចរួមបញ្ចូល ...

អាន​បន្ថែម

រាប់ Submatrices ជាមួយនឹងដំណោះស្រាយ LeetCode ទាំងអស់។

សេចក្តីថ្លែងការណ៍បញ្ហាចំនួន Submatrices ជាមួយនឹងដំណោះស្រាយ LeetCode ទាំងអស់ - យើងត្រូវបានផ្តល់ម៉ាទ្រីសគោលពីរ mxn ហើយត្រូវបានស្នើសុំឱ្យត្រឡប់ចំនួននៃ submatrices ដែលមានទាំងអស់។ ឧទាហរណ៍ និងការពន្យល់ ឧទាហរណ៍ 1: បញ្ចូល៖ mat = [[1,0,1],[1,1,0],[1,1,0]] Output: 13 Explanation: មាន 6 ចតុកោណចំហៀង…

អាន​បន្ថែម

ទីតាំងភ្លឺបំផុតនៅលើដំណោះស្រាយផ្លូវ LeetCode

សេចក្តីថ្លែងការណ៍បញ្ហា ទីតាំងភ្លឺបំផុតនៅលើដំណោះស្រាយផ្លូវ LeetCode - យើងត្រូវបានស្នើឱ្យសន្មត់បន្ទាត់លេខតំណាងឱ្យផ្លូវមួយ។ ផ្លូវនេះមានចង្កៀងនៅលើវា។ យើងត្រូវបានផ្តល់អារេចំនួនគត់ 2D "ភ្លើង" ។ ភ្លើងនីមួយៗ[i] = [position_i, range_i] បង្ហាញថាមានចង្កៀងផ្លូវនៅលើ position_i ដែលអាច…

អាន​បន្ថែម

ដំណោះស្រាយក្លូនក្រាហ្វ LeetCode

សេចក្តីថ្លែងការណ៍បញ្ហាក្លូនក្រាហ្វ លីតកូដ ដំណោះស្រាយ - យើងត្រូវបានផ្តល់ឯកសារយោងនៃថ្នាំងនៅក្នុងក្រាហ្វដែលមិនទាក់ទងគ្នា ហើយត្រូវបានស្នើសុំឱ្យត្រឡប់ច្បាប់ចម្លងជ្រៅនៃក្រាហ្វ។ ច្បាប់ចម្លងជ្រៅ គឺជាក្លូនជាមូលដ្ឋាន ដែលមិនមានថ្នាំងណាមួយនៅក្នុងច្បាប់ចម្លងជ្រៅគួរមានឯកសារយោង…

អាន​បន្ថែម

Translate »